According to MoveBudhha, “The typical cost for hiring movers in Portland is $130 per hour, with the total cost to move ranging from $460 to $4,270, on average.” However, this can vary on a multitude of factors

Start by visiting The Federal Motor Carrier Safety Administration (FMCSA) official website.
From there you can perform a search using a moving company’s ODOT licence. If a company does not have an ODOT license listed on their website, then chances are they are not licensed.
